| Analysis: In the June-over-June traffic report, Great Lakes reversed the slower growth it experienced in May; however, it has not returned to the double-digit pace recorder earlier this year. Great Lakes was able to balance the growth in traffic and capacity, but still boost its load factor on its turboprop fleet. { } Indicates code-share partnerships Source: Company reports | ||||||
